When sex is practiced outside of marriage, you are misusing it and there are personal and interpersonal consequences. Sex outside of marriage is incomplete, because it doesn’t have a binding union as its basis. So when you have sex outside of marriage, what you are really saying is, “I want to have physical union with you, but not the entanglements of any other kind of binding union.” Most people don’t consciously think like that when they are having sex before marriage, yet, that is what they are doing and communicating—no matter how much they say they care for their partner.
